Vikhrs dropping to the ground immediately


Recommended Posts

I just noticed that sometimes my vikhrs turn to the ground immediately after launch. this never happened to me in BS1. Is that a feature simulating defective vikhrs? it happens with roughly 2 of the 12 missiles and i am very shure that they were within the guidance beam.

Here are some screens where i ripple-fired 2 vikhrs: one went for the target and one hit the ground.

 

Edit : I forgot to say: this was the 1.1.2.1 beta for black shark in DCS World

In my experience, if you have a problem with the laser from the get-go, the Vikhr will go pretty much straight for the ground. It's only after it's in relatively stable flight that a guidance issue will cause it to deviate slowly, at least for me.

no, i checked this. when i fire a vikhr with the laser off it does not make such a narrow turn to the ground. Furthermore as you might be able to see on the 2. screenshot the smoke the vikhr produces before it starts spinning is much shorter on the one dropping to the ground than the one working normally. thats because it was very slow. and that should not be caused by anything that has to do with the laser.
